2015-0376

INTRODUCED BY:                     PAUL J. HOGAN, PE, COUNCILMAN, DISTRICT IV

RESOLUTION NO.                                             

Title

A resolution to authorize the Council Chairman to immediately take the steps needed to employ Special Legal Counsel to represent the St. Charles Parish Council in having a court of competent jurisdiction compel the Parish President to perform his legal obligation to enter into a contract, prior to December 31, 2015, to perform a budgeted task which he is legally obligated to do, to raise and dispose the sunken vessel "Pretty Boy" from the Scenic Waterway Bayou Des Allemands 1) immediately following the passing of two (2) working days after the receipt of an AG opinion if it is received prior to the end of the day on November 16, 2015 and it confirms that the spending of the budgeted funds is not gratuitous spending of public funds, since the Parish President has advised the Council at the October 19, 2015 council meeting that he will not lift the vessel even if the AG opines that the expenditure of the budgeted funds is legal, or 2) upon not receiving a fully executed contract by 4:00 pm, November 18, 2015 should the AG opinion not be received prior to 4:00 pm, November 18, 2015, whichever occurs sooner.

Body

WHEREAS,                     on October 28, 2014, the Parish Council approved Amendment No. 7 which amended the proposed Consolidated Operating and Capital Budget for Fiscal Year 2015, to add $30,000.00 in Special Revenue Funds - Road & Drainage/Drainage (Account Number: 112-420260) - Operating Services/Drainage - Professional Services for raising and disposal of the vessel; and,

WHEREAS,                     on October 28, 2014, the Parish Council adopted Ordinance No. 14-10-20, which approved and adopted the appropriation of Funds for the St. Charles Consolidated Operating and Capital Budget for Fiscal Year 2015 which included the funds necessary to raise and dispose of the vessel; and,

WHEREAS,                     on March 16, 2015, the Parish Council adopted Resolution No. 6146, which requested an Attorney General Opinion as to the steps and/or actions it has at its disposal to have a project for which funds have been appropriated and approved in the Parish budget implemented; and,

WHEREAS,                     the Attorney General has issued Opinion 15-0041 which opined that the Parish President must execute the authorizations set forth in the budget; and,

WHEREAS,                     the Parish President has been taking every step possible at his disposal to avoid having to perform the budgeted task; and,

WHEREAS,                     the Parish President requested bids to dispose of the vessel with the hope and expectation that the cost would be in excess of the budgeted funds; and,

WHEREAS,                     the Parish President subsequently received a quote in the amount of $29,000 from Couvillion Group, LLC to dispose of the vessel which ended up being under the budgeted amount; and,

WHEREAS,                     the Parish President requested an AG opinion to confirm that the spending of the budgeted funds is not gratuitous spending of public funds; and,

WHEREAS,                     the Parish President indicated at the October 19, 2015, council meeting that he will not have the budgeted project performed, even if the AG opines that the spending of the funds is proper; and,

WHEREAS,                     the Parish Council wishes to have this resolution passed and in place so as to have the authority to immediately hire an attorney to take the steps needed in order to have a court of competent jurisdiction direct the Parish President to implement the project should the Parish President not take the steps needed to have the task performed.

 

N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ED, THAT WE, THE MEMBERS OF THE ST. CHARLES PARISH COUNCIL, do hereby authorize the Council Chairman to immediately take the steps needed to employ Special Legal Counsel to represent the St. Charles Parish Council in having a court of competent jurisdiction compel the Parish President to perform his legal obligation to enter into a contract, prior to December 31, 2015, to perform a budgeted task which he is legally obligated to do, to raise and dispose the sunken vessel "Pretty Boy" from the Scenic Waterway Bayou Des Allemands 1) immediately following the passing of two (2) working days after the receipt of an AG opinion if it is received prior to the end of the day on November 16, 2015 and it confirms that the spending of the budgeted funds is not gratuitous spending of public funds, since the Parish President has advised the Council at the October 19, 2015 council meeting that he will not lift the vessel even if the AG opines that the expenditure of the budgeted funds is legal, or 2) upon not receiving a fully executed contract by 4:00 pm, November 18, 2015 should the AG opinion not be received prior to 4:00 pm, November 18, 2015, whichever occurs sooner.
